Docker容器是Docker镜像的运行实例。镜像可以看作是一个类,而容器则是这个类的实例。 在Docker中,用户可以通过Docker镜像来创建Docker容器。镜像中包含了应用程序的代码、运行时环境、系统工具等,容器则是在镜像的基础上运行起来的进程。容器可以被启动、停止、删除等操作,而镜像本身是不可更改的。 因此,Docker镜像和容...
Docker 容器和镜像之间的关系可以理解为蓝图和实例的关系:1、定义: Docker 镜像是容器的只读模板,包含了运行容器所需的代码、库、环境变量和配置文件。2、实例化: 当 Docker 镜像运行时,它会成为一个容器,即镜像的实时、可写版本。3、层叠构建: Docker 镜像是通过一系列的层叠构建而成,每个层代表镜像构建过...
容器和镜像的关系是什么呢?
Docker镜像:是一个只读的模板,它包含了创建Docker容器所需的文件系统结构和应用程序,可以将其看作是一个静态的文件系统快照。 Docker容器:是基于Docker镜像运行的一个独立进程,它是镜像的一个实例,容器提供了应用程序运行所需的所有依赖项和环境。 2、关系: 基于镜像创建容器:每个容器都是从一个Docker镜像创建而来的...
docker 镜像和容器的关系是什么?容器是镜像的实例,先描述镜像,再创建容器,所以容器可以有多个。镜像是一个只读的文件系统,在本地会共用,主要是通过签名来实现的,类似于存储里面的De-dup技术。 每运行一个容器,会在镜像上加一个可写层,但这一层并不会改变镜像本身,这也就是为什么有时候你用同一个镜像启动多个容...
镜像(Image)和容器(Container)的关系,就像是面向对象程序设计中的类 和 实例 一样,镜像是静态的定义,容器是镜像运行时的实体。容器可以被创建、启动、停止、删除、暂停等。容器的实质是进程,但与直接在宿主执行的进程不同,容器进程运行于属于自己的独立的命名空间。前面讲过镜像使用的是分层存储,容器也是如此。容器...
是docker容器运行时的只读模板,镜像可以用来创建docker容器。每个镜像由一系列层的(layers)组成,Docker使用的UFS(联合文件系统)来将这些层联合到单独的镜像中。 UFS允许独立文件系统中的文件和文件夹被透明覆盖,形成一个单独连贯的文件系统,正因为有了这些镜像层的存在,docker是如此的轻量,当你改变一个docker镜像,比如...
Docker的Image(镜像)和Containter(容器)是什么关系? container is like the instance of class “Image” 就是说 image是图纸 可以多次复用,但是容器不行。
Docker 容器和镜像之间的关系可以理解为蓝图和实例的关系: 1、定义: Docker 镜像是容器的只读模板,包含了运行容器所需的代码、库、环境变量和配置文件。 2、实例化: 当 Docker 镜像运行时,它会成为一个容器,即镜像的实时、可写版本。 3、层叠构建: Docker 镜像是通过一系列的层叠构建而成,每个层代...
镜像(Image)和容器(Container)的关系,就像是面向对象程序设计中的类 和 实例 一样,镜像是静态的定义,容器是镜像运行时的实体。容器可以被创建、启动、停止、删除、暂停等。容器的实质是进程,但与直接在宿主执行的进程不同,容器进程运行于属于自己的独立的命名空间。前面讲过镜像使用的是分层存储,容器也是如此。容器...